Chapter 47: A Different Kind of Mage

Lucius Malfoy stared, his horror complete.

Clones?Ā He'd seen many dark and complex spells in his service to the Dark Lord, but never one that created perfect, physical duplicates.

But that wasn't what truly terrified him.

Flight.

The boy was flying. No broom. No visible charm. He simply hovered in the air. That was a magic only the Dark Lord himself had ever demonstrated before them. Not even Dumbledore could manage it. And now this sixteen-year-old boy was doing it effortlessly.

The blood drained from Lucius's face. Had they been sent to capture someone as powerful as the Dark Lord?

The other three Death Eaters felt the same icy dread. Their wands felt slippery in their sweaty hands. All their confidence vanished, replaced by a crushing sense of doom. But the thought of failing the Dark Lord was even more terrifying.

"NOW!" one of them shrieked, desperation overriding fear. A Stunning Spell shot from his wand.

The reaction was instantaneous. The three clones surrounding him didn't even cast a spell. Instead, shimmering golden-red shields of light—not of any magic they recognized—sprang to life in their hands. The Stunning Spell hit a shield and dissipated without a sound.

Then, the clones charged.

The Death Eater's eyes widened in panic. Wizarding duels were about distance, about spellwork. This… this was like being rushed by a trio of silent, shielded knights. He fired spell after spell, but each was effortlessly blocked. Every clone felt solid, real. This was no illusion.

Elian, at the center of it all, felt no need for dramatic speeches. This needed to end, and quickly. The Dark Mark would bring others. Adults. Questions.

A thought, and his thirteen forms moved as one. Rings of golden energy shimmered into existence around their wrists. In their other hands, blades of condensed, fiery light formed from nothing.

It was over in seconds.

The three Death Eaters who had stood their ground fell, not with the flash of green light, but silently. They collapsed to the forest floor, defeated.

Elian's gaze snapped to the fourth.

But where Lucius Malfoy had been, there was only empty space. A faintĀ crackĀ of Apparition still hung in the air. The man, ever cautious, had fled the moment the clones appeared, abandoning his comrades to their fate.

The clones vanished. Elian lowered himself to the ground, the Levitation Cloak settling. He looked at the five fallen figures. The Death Eaters had been… weaker than he expected. Or perhaps he was simply stronger now. Most were just bullies with wands, terrifying only to those who feared them. He did not.

His goal was mostly achieved. Lucius had escaped, but the message would be delivered. The "Child of the Prophecy" was not an easy target. The Icon Illusion had worked perfectly. Let Voldemort hear of it. Let him wonder.

He needed to leave. Now.

He raised his hand, the Sling Ring already beginning to spark with golden light.

A series of sharpĀ CRACKSĀ split the air.

Too late.

Figures apparated into the clearing all around him—wizards in everyday robes, their faces etched with panic and fury, wands already drawn. They took in the scene: the Dark Mark above, the black-robed bodies on the ground, and a lone, unfamiliar teenager standing amidst them.

They didn't wait for an explanation.

"GET HIM!" a witch screamed, her voice raw with fear. "Take down all the Death Eaters!"

A dozen wands pointed directly at Elian.
